You will not be able to alter the tax band of your car, all cars are tested and allocated an emmissions level before being put onto the UK market and that is the emmissions level stays for every car of that model. Aftermarket changes can not change the tax band.

It wouldn't matter even if you could make it greener, the government bases the tax on the carbon emissions for your make and model. They will not take into account individual cars as that would make the tax system completely unworkable.
